James Griffiths Wins in Worcestershire!
Taking his cue from his seniors at the Tour of Italy, James Griffiths of the
Linda McCartney-WCU Under-23 squad took Linda McCartney's second win of the
weekend at the Arctic 2000 Tour d'Espoirs event in Worcesterhire.
The race formed Round 2 of the season long Under-23 series, the team's main
objective for 2000. James now lies in 3rd place overall, close behind leader
Jamie Alberts of the lottery-funded World Class Performance Plan.
"It's always going to be tough when we go head-to-head with the boys from the
"Plan", so I was exceptionally pleased with the performance," said the
satisfied team manager, Chris Lillywhite. Chris had flown in especially for
the event, after helping the senior team through their first week in the Giro
d'Italia.
James was the driving force in a five-man break that looked as if it would
decide the race, but they were joined by 3 dangerous chasers as the race
reached the 20km to go mark. Not wanting to wait for the sprint, and hoping
to take advantage of the tough roads around the Malvern Hills, James launched
a devastating attack that only Alberts could respond to. Alberts was on his
limit, and unable to contribute to the move, and just before the finish, they
were recaptured by the others. Alberts made an early move when the race
reached the final climb to the line, but James countered him, and coasted
over the line with 5 seconds to spare.
"I was so thrilled after seeing David McKenzie win at the Tour of Italy on
Eurosport on Saturday, that I really wanted to win today," said the happy
victor. "It's my best win yet, and this team is now going from strength to
strength.

In another great piece of news on an amazing weekend, Huw Pritchard flew to
the Netherlands as part of the Great Britain team contesting the Olympia Tour
of Holland. The international recognition comes as a result of Huw's
excellent progress in a Linda McCartney-WCU jersey this season.
The Linda McCartney-WCU Under-23 team will be heading on to the prestigious
Tour of Serbia next week. Joining them will be American Matt De Canio of the
senior team, back from North Carolina. Huw will be with them, and then he and
Matt will go to Spain for the Circuito Montanes with some of the guys riding
the Giro d'Italia.
Speaking of which, all 7 of the Giro team made it through the dangerous
mountain stage to Abertone, finishing comfortably in the big bunch as per
team manager Sean Yates's instructions. "This is not our sort of stage,
survival is the name of the day, and then we'll look to the next stage. I'm
